Market Overview - On January 8, major stock markets in Europe and the U.S. mostly rose, with the Dow Jones Industrial Average increasing by 0.55%, while the Nasdaq index fell by 0.44% and the S&P 500 index rose slightly by 0.01% [3] - The large-cap technology stocks in the U.S. showed mixed performance, with the Wind U.S. Technology Seven Giants Index declining by 0.26% [5] - Energy stocks experienced a significant rise, with ConocoPhillips and Occidental Petroleum both increasing by over 5% [9] Chinese Stocks - The Nasdaq China Golden Dragon Index rose by 1.09%, with notable gains in Chinese stocks such as Century Internet, which increased by over 10%, and GDS Holdings, which rose by over 8% [7][8] Commodity Market - The precious metals market saw significant volatility, with London spot silver and COMEX silver futures both dropping over 5% at one point before narrowing their losses to over 1% by the end of the trading day [14] - Crude oil futures prices rose significantly, with both WTI and Brent crude oil futures increasing by over 4% [14] Employment Data - The U.S. Department of Labor reported that the number of initial jobless claims for the week ending January 3 was 208,000, slightly below the expected 210,000 [12] - Continuing claims for unemployment benefits were reported at 1.914 million, slightly above the expected 1.90 million [12]
